Pipelining and Concurrency Techniques for Groups of Graphics Processing Work

Last updated:

Abstract:

Techniques are disclosed relating to processing groups of graphics work (which may be referred to as "kicks") using a graphics processing pipeline. In some embodiments, a graphics processor includes multiple sets of configuration registers such that multiple kicks can be processed in the pipeline at the same time. In some embodiments, kicks are pipelined such that a subsequent kick ramps up use of hardware resources as a previous kick winds down. In some embodiments, the graphics processing may execute kicks concurrently and/or preemptively, e.g., based on a priority scheme. In some embodiments, the disclosed techniques may be used with pipelines that include front and back-end fixed function circuitry as well as shared programmable resources such as shader cores. In various embodiments, the disclosed techniques may improve overall performance and/or reduce latency for high-priority graphics tasks.
